Week 4 Packet DownloadHot Cross BunsDo you remember playing hot cross buns on recorders? We didn't quite get to it on our ukuleles. BUT I have a Hot Cross Buns challenge for you! Please watch the video below: Now it's your turn! With adult permission, collect 3 glasses (water glasses, cups, mason jars) and add just enough water so you have the pitches to play Hot Cross Buns by gently tapping each glass with a pencil.
